Pro 3rd person platformer without the need to control the camera
Lucky's tale is a 3rd person platformer (much like Mario 64) that normally requires manual control of the camera. By creating the game for VR the user will not need to mess around with camera controls while also needing to control the character as the camera is your head. As you move your head the camera moves, which is not only a lot more intuitive but takes the multitasking out of the gameplay leaving the player to concentrate on controls only.

Con Slightly too repetitive
The gameplay mechanic consists of avoiding obstacles while falling off buildings and getting more points for riskier maneuvers. It doesn't really change much throughout the levels, making it feel like more of the same.
